BTC price at press time values at $68,230.90 with profit-making gains of 4.0%. While the market cap of the coin is around $1,287,377,285,127. The trading volume for the last 24-hours levitates around $40,559,489,832. As aforementioned the digital asset hit its new ATH of $68,641.57 a couple of hours prior to press time.
Bitcoin had previously brushed levels of $67,000 following the launch of Proshares ETF in the U.S. The digital asset has grown about 58.12% ever since the start of the fourth quarter. A breakthrough above $69,000, could further propel its price to $70,000 levels. On the flip side, the immediate support is near $68,000. While the major support is around $67,000.
